June 4 (Reuters) - The following bids, mergers, acquisitions and disposals were reported by 2000 GMT on Thursday:
** LaserAway is exploring a sale that could value the medical spa chain at more than $2 billion, according to people familiar with the matter. nL6N42917Y
** Indian renewable energy firm Inox Clean Energy INOC.NS said it has entered into an agreement to acquire Vena Energy India's 6-gigawatt renewable energy portfolio, bolstering its operating capacity and project pipeline. nL4N42C0YZ
** The chief executive of ITV said that the British broadcaster was still "very much actively engaged" in a deal to sell its media and entertainment division to Comcast's Sky. nS8N40409B
** U.S. investment firm Castlelake is looking at MSC, the world's largest shipping group, as a partner in a consortium for a potential takeover bid on British budget airline easyJet EZJ.L, Italian daily Corriere della Sera reported.nL8N42C098
** Japan's Yamada Holdings 9831.T and Edion 2730.T said that they plan to merge, aiming to create a giant consumer electronics chain with combined sales of around $16 billion. nL6N42B15B
** Canadian power producer TransAlta Corp TA.TO said on Wednesday it will acquire two natural gas-fired peaking facilities near Denver, Colorado, from Blackstone BX.N for about $1 billion, strengthening its presence in the Western U.S. power market. nL4N42B1TT
